By 2005, Waller had left his job and moved to
Portland, Oregon with the intention of becoming a full-time musician and artist. He has a sister named Leslie, and a niece named Emily.

From 2000 to 2004, Waller worked in the information technology department of an internet hosting company, which allowed him to fund his next two albums.

Waller has recently scored the film, "We Were Here: Voices from the AIDS Years in San
Francisco," by David Weissman and Bill Weber.
